Ah word. Apparently there is a Daphon dealer in Connecticut here, i dunno what the deal is in Canuckistan.
One thing worth noting, Daphon sells basically the exact same pedal under half a dozen names. The pedals generally look exactly like the one i posted, same black label, even the same exact model number. Literally the only thing that is different is that it says something other than Daphon on it.
Daphon E20MT Heavy Metal Carlson E20MT Heavy Metal Da Aqua E20MT Heavy Metal Dot On Shaft E20MT Heavy Metal Roberts E20MT Heavy Metal Shelter E20MT Heavy Metal Swamp E20MT Heavy Metal
That might help if you have trouble finding them. Random toy stores carry them too. I have seen the E20DS(the orange one) in a couple stores at least.
